WebJul 17, 2024 · Carroll. The Carroll surname (and variants such as O'Carroll) can be found throughout Ireland, including Armagh, Down, Fermanagh, Kerry, Kilkenny, Leitrim, Louth, Monaghan, and Offaly. There is also a MacCarroll family (anglicized to MacCarvill) from the province of Ulster.

WebAug 1, 2024 · 23 Madigan. This feisty little Irish name is known to be unisex and is slightly different depending on how you use it. Madigan is Irish and it means, “little dog,” either way. However when used as a girl’s name the name brings to mind a similarity to Madison or Madeline, making it sound more feminine. WebAug 2, 2024 · Giants Causeway Co. Antrim Armagh – Ard Mhaca . Ard Mhaca means Macha’s height. Macha is an Irish Celtic Goddess associated with Ulster and Armagh..
